Optical Properties and Structure of Highly Concentrated Solutions of Cellulose in N-Methylmorpholine N-Oxide

2001 
The nature of the anisotropy of highly concentrated solutions of cellulose in MMO was investigated. The temperature-concentration intervals of the existence of nonequilibrium and thermodynamically equilibrium anisotropic states of cellulose in solutions of MMO were detected and determined. The proposed explanation of the specific features of the reaction of cellulose with MMO, which results in the formation of a mesophase, does not exhaust the group of problems of the mechanism of ordering of highly concentrated cellulose solutions and the structural characteristics of the liquid-crystalline phase formed. An examination of these questions requires conducting further detailed studies.
